Default How do you quote someone?

I can' t seem to figure it out! Do you highlight a sentence first? Which icon do you use?

You mean like that? Just highlight the text you want to quote, then click on the first little icon in the same box you highlighted the text in, up and to the right of the text, its the reply icon. that should do it.
